EPISODE 339: Have you ever wondered what it’s like to step into the construction industry as a woman and not just survive but thrive?

Women make up only about 11% of the construction industry. More often than not, they have to prove themselves to be taken seriously. But women bring much more than most people realize.

So, in this week’s episode, we’ve invited four incredible women: our host Leyah Hostetter, Emily Reidy Twigg of Forest Glen Construction, Cassie Parra of Tru Builders, and Shannon Springstead of John Springstead Construction.

These women grew up on construction sites, learned the ropes from their fathers, and are now leading successful careers in the construction industry.

Listen in as these inspiring women share their unique journeys, the challenges they’ve faced as women in construction, the invaluable lessons they’ve learned from their fathers, and much more.
